Here are some of the issues with the Lucas D. Smith Kenyan Birth Certificate:
1) Smith tried to sell his copy on E-Bay
2) The hospital administrator is wrong. In “February 19 of 2009,” the date stamped on the Smith document and the month when Smith claims he visited Kenya, the chief administrator of the hospital was Jennifer Othigo. Her tenure included “February 19 of 2009” because of newspaper articles naming her as chief administrator on February 1, 2009 and February 26, 2009. Maganga, the person listed as chief administrator on the Smith document did not assume that post until months later.
3) The certificate bears the seal of the hospital. A seal signifies a certified copy. Generally hospitals don’t issue certified copies, jurisdictions do. The seal should be that of the government of Kenya (or the district), not the hospital.
4) worldnetdaily.com says they have a real Kenyan birth certificate from the time period, and this one doesn’t look the one they published. This is not a fatal error because the WND document is a real government-issued birth certificate, while the Lucas document would be closer to a hospital souvenir birth certificate.
4) The signature has the pre-printed title “Supervisor of Obstetrics” when there are all sorts of conditions when someone else might sign the form. In pretty much any real form, the title of the signer is a blank to be filled in. For example, the Bomford example from South Australia has a blank to fill in.
5) Neither parent signed the certificate. Of course if this is only a hospital souvenir, then the parents would not have to sign, but why is is a souvenir sealed and signed to make it look like an official document? On an official birth registration form the person providing the information about father and mother (i.e. the father or mother) must sign the form.
If a pregnant Ann Obama was going to Kenya in 1961, Mombasa was the last place she should have been delivering a baby. Mombasa is on the eastern coast, the airport is in Nairobi in the center of the country and the grandparents’ village was in the opposite direction from Mombasa on Kenya’s western border. Mombasa was a stupid mistake made early on (e.g. in the original complaint of Berg v Obama), and copied by true believers ever since.
Obama Sr.’s father was against the marriage and Obama Sr. already had a wife there, which begs the question of why to go to Africa in the first place and particularly in the middle of a civil war.
6) The date format used throughout the document is mm/dd/yy. Kenya uses dd/yy/mm format. Kenyan university application requirements pages located online specify that birth certificates are in dd/yy/mm format. (Smith claims that Kenya used both British and American date formats, but provided no reason to believe that this is true).
7) Obama Sr’s birth date is only a year but Stanley Ann shows a full date of birth. Why is the the father’s full date of birth missing? The year was all that was on the Wikipedia, but we now know from immigration files that the day of birth was June 18, but this was not known publicly when the Smith Kenyan certificate surfaced. This is a bit of a smoking gun.
8) The Smith Kenyan birth certificate has been submitted as an exhibit to several courts, going back to 2009 and as recently as last month in an all-Republican appeal before the all-Republican Alabama Supreme Court (McInnish, Goode v. Chapman). This birth certificate has had no positive impact on the outcome of any trial or appeal.
